What is Prostamax?

Prostamax is a peptide bioregulator from the Russian program, designed to target prostate tissue. It is studied in animal research for its effects on prostate-tissue signaling in the context of aging.

  • A short peptide studied for its effects on prostate tissue
  • Part of the Russian organ-targeted bioregulator research program
  • Studied in aged animal models for its effects on prostate-cell gene activity
  • Investigated alongside other organ-specific bioregulators from the same program

Prostamax, also known by its tetrapeptide designation KEDP (Lys-Glu-Asp-Pro), is a synthetic tetrapeptide bioregulator with a molecular weight of 487.50 g/mol. Developed at the Saint Petersburg Institute of Bioregulation and Gerontology as part of the Khavinson peptide bioregulator series, Prostamax was designed based on peptide fractions associated with prostate tissue. Its sequence, Lys-Glu-Asp-Pro, incorporates a C-terminal proline residue, a conformationally constrained amino acid that introduces a characteristic backbone turn and may influence the peptide’s interaction with target nucleotide sequences. Like other tetrapeptide bioregulators in the Khavinson series, Prostamax is proposed to modulate tissue-specific gene expression through direct DNA interaction. Produced via solid-phase peptide synthesis, Prostamax is associated with prostatic tissue gene expression.

Prostamax is as an organ-specific tetrapeptide bioregulator within the Khavinson framework. A dedicated in vivo study has documented KEDP-specific activity on prostatic tissue: in sulpiride-treated Wistar rats used as a model of benign prostatic hyperplasia, administration of the tetrapeptide Lys-Glu-Asp-Pro was associated with reductions in prostate weight and volume and a decrease in acini epithelial area relative to untreated controls, with the comparison drawn against a Serenoa repens reference preparation [1]. At the mechanistic level, consistent with the proposed direct-to-DNA mode of action, peptides of the Khavinson ultrashort class have been shown in cell-free and cellular systems to penetrate the cell nucleus and bind DNA in a sequence-selective manner, providing a structural basis for peptide-directed modulation of gene expression [2], making Prostamax a reference compound in preclinical urological bioregulation research examining prostate-tropic short-peptide activity, benign prostatic hyperplasia models, and direct-to-DNA mechanisms of tissue-specific gene regulation.
